Reserve Bank of India organizing Financial Literacy Week
Listen to this Article
According to an RBI official, the bank is leaving no stone unturned to accelerate the level of outreach of the initiative. For this, a pilot project for financial literacy in 80 blocks of 9 states has been devised, in which 6 NGOs have registered themselves in Depositor education and awareness fund. RBI has also signed pact with 10 banks to provide financial education. Target groups of this initiative are farmers, industrialists, school students, senior citizens and self- help groups. #casansaar (Source - NewsOnAir)
